McLaren Industries Introduces New Industrial, OTR Tires

With more than 10 years of field testing and continuous improvements of the tire structure, McLaren’s Nu-Air semi-pneumatic tire series integrates the strength and stability of a solid tire with the smooth, cushioned ride of a pneumatic tire. With its lower cost/hour the Nu-Air tire has become widely known as the smart alternative to foam filled tires and regular pneumatic tires, according to the manuafacturer.

Originally skid steer loaders and some backhoes were eligible for solid cushion tires. For years OEMs and equipment users have been reporting higher equipment productivity and reduced maintenance costs derived from the usage of such tires. The continuous positive results and the numerous inquiries about more other tire sizes motivated McLaren’s R&D department to invest in new tire sizes, and apply the semi-pneumatic tire technology for heavy construction equipment as well.

Up to now only OEMs had access to a limited OTR range of tire sizes. The company now introduces the full range both to the OEM and to the retail market. Thus, industry manufacturers and users of backhoes, telehandlers, front end loaders, wheel loaders, and wheeled excavators finally have access to the technology that was once available to compact equipment only.

The OTR solid cushion tires are not only an alternative to foam filled or solid tires, but to the heavy and expensive tire chains preferred by many mining companies. The flat proof technology eliminates the need for tire prevention, while the extra weight of the tires provides the stability that is crucial on any harsh terrain. There is a variety of patterns available, allowing customers to select the right tire for their type of terrain. The RT pattern for size 20.5x25 has been developed precisely for problematic surfaces, where rocks, scrap and debris give a hard time even to the most experience operators.

The new sizes cover almost the entire OTR range.
